Transaction e139423b53768284c3384a790b550de5db486b132c48e85f4e9b53f4c066924c
1 Input
1 Output
-
e139423b53768284c3384a790b550de5db486b132c48e85f4e9b53f4c066924c:0
- value
- 630095
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b3b7b1f2e3a963575d1cede5c9b788ab17742282 OP_EQUAL
- address
- 3J5GwExtZWVutYyYZKNcWesdDjhSrYjoor